Characteristics

The Collie with Mudi mix is a medium to large-sized dog with a sturdy build. They typically inherit the long, flowing coat of the Collie, which can come in a variety of colors such as sable, tricolor, blue merle, or white. Their ears may be erect like the Mudi or drop like the Collie, giving them a unique and adorable look. They have expressive eyes that are usually brown or blue, adding to their charm.

Due to their Collie ancestry, these dogs are known for their intelligence and trainability. They are quick learners and eager to please, making them excellent candidates for obedience training and agility competitions. They also have a strong herding instinct, which may manifest in their behavior towards other animals or children in the household.

Temperament

The Collie with Mudi mix is a friendly and affectionate dog that thrives on human companionship. They are known for their gentle nature and playful demeanor, making them great family pets. They are good with children and other pets, although early socialization is important to ensure they develop good manners and proper behavior around others.

These dogs are also very energetic and require plenty of exercise to keep them happy and healthy. They enjoy going for long walks, runs, or hikes, and they excel in activities that challenge both their physical and mental abilities. Without proper exercise and stimulation, they may become bored and exhibit destructive behaviors.

Care Needs

When it comes to grooming, the Collie with Mudi mix requires regular maintenance to keep their coat looking its best. They will need to be brushed several times a week to prevent tangles and mats, especially during shedding season. They may also need occasional trims to keep their coat neat and tidy.

In terms of health, this mixed breed may inherit some of the common health issues seen in Collies and Mudis. These may include hip dysplasia, eye problems, and skin allergies. Regular veterinary check-ups and a healthy diet are essential to ensure they stay in good health throughout their lives.

Training and socialization are also important for this mix, as they are intelligent and active dogs that require mental stimulation and guidance. Positive reinforcement methods work best with them, as they respond well to praise and rewards.
